Trastuzumab is a monoclonal antibody used to treat breast cancer and stomach cancer. It is specifically used for cancer that is HER2 receptor positive.

Most common side effects of Trastuzumab include headaches, dizziness, joint and muscle pain, rash, vomiting (being sick), breathlessness, flu-like symptoms, feeling sick, soreness at the injection site, diarrhoea, allergic reactions and blood clots.
Care should be exercised in the handling of HERTRAZ. Hertraz 440 mg Injection should be protected from light and should retain in the original carton until use. Store permitted between 2-8°C (36-46°F).
The active ingredient in the medicine is Trastuzumab, and the inactive ingredients are α,α-trehalose dihydrate, L-histidine HCl, L-histidine, and polysorbate 20.
